The Engagement Crisis in Traditional Education

Traditional education — at every level from secondary school to professional training — struggles with learner engagement. Passive content delivery, whether in a lecture hall or an e-learning module, produces low engagement and even lower retention. XR addresses this engagement crisis by replacing passive consumption with active, immersive experience — a fundamentally different cognitive mode that produces dramatically better learning outcomes.

Making the Abstract Tangible

One of XR's most powerful educational applications is making abstract concepts experiential. Chemistry students can manipulate molecular structures in 3D. History students can walk through ancient civilisations. Medical students can explore the human body from the inside. Engineering students can interact with full-scale machinery that no physical training facility could accommodate. XR collapses the distance between concept and experience.
